Raccoon Fun Facts:
- Raccoons live in North America. They are common.
- They grow up to 28″ long and can weigh up to 20lbs.
- Raccoon are omnivores. They will eat almost anything, from invertebrates to plants to small animals.
- Raccoons have 40 teeth!
- They live in all kind of habitats, from swamps to forests to cities.
- Raccoons are famous for their masked faces.
- Raccoons are nocturnal.
- They are known to wash their food off in creeks or streams.
- Raccoons do not hibernate, but they do store fat before the winter and lose up to 50% of their body weight.
- Raccoons have 5 digits on their front paws. These fingers act like human hands in a way.
- They are excellent climbers and swimmers!
